반응형

.net(dotnet) 버전 설명 및 비교

 

구현 포함된 버전
.NET .NET Core 1.0~3.1 / .NET 5 이상 버전의 .NET
.NET Framework .NET Framework 1.0 ~ 4.8

 

.NET 사용하는 경우

  • 플랫폼(windows / mac os / Linux 등등) 간 요구 사항이 있습니다.
  • 마이크로 서비스를 대상으로 합니다.
  • Docker 컨테이너를 사용하고 있습니다.
  • 고성능 및 확장 가능한 시스템이 필요합니다.
  • .NET 버전이 애플리케이션별로 함께 필요합니다.

 

.NET Framework 사용하는 경우

  • 앱이 현재 .NET Framework를 사용합니다(마이그레이션하는 대신 확장 권장).
  • 앱이 .NET에 사용할 수 없는 타사 라이브러리 또는 NuGet 패키지를 사용합니다.
  • 앱이 .NET에 사용할 수 없는 .NET Framework 기술을 사용합니다.
  • 앱이 .NET을 지원하지 않는 플랫폼을 사용합니다.

 

참고 문서 : https://learn.microsoft.com/ko-kr/dotnet/standard/choosing-core-framework-server

반응형

+ Recent posts